On 6 July 2022 at the 9th Session of the General Assembly of the UNESCO Convention on the Protection of Intangible Cultural Heritage at UNESCO Headquarters in Paris, France, Vietnam was elected a Member of the Intergovernmental Committee of the UNESCO Convention on the Protection of Intangible Cultural Heritage with 120 out of 155 votes, the highest in the Group IV of Asia-Pacific nations, and the highest among the elected countries.
